What It Is:
This is a worksheet titled 'Write Your Own' designed to help students practice using adjectives. The worksheet contains incomplete sentences with blanks where students are expected to fill in an appropriate adjective. Each sentence is accompanied by a related image to provide context. Examples include 'Gymnastics is for Lucy,' 'We are taking a route,' and 'This camera is very .' There are a total of seven sentences.
Grade Level Suitability:
This worksheet is suitable for grades 1-3. The sentences are simple and the vocabulary is age-appropriate. The task of filling in adjectives is a fundamental grammar skill taught in these grades. The images provide visual cues to aid younger learners.
Why Use It:
This worksheet reinforces the understanding and use of adjectives. It helps students expand their vocabulary and practice sentence construction. The visual aids make the activity more engaging and accessible to visual learners. It encourages creative thinking as students choose appropriate adjectives to complete each sentence.
How to Use It:
Provide the worksheet to students and instruct them to read each sentence carefully. Then, have them choose an adjective that makes sense in the context of the sentence and the accompanying image. Students should write their chosen adjective in the blank space provided. Review the completed worksheet to ensure the adjectives are grammatically correct and contextually appropriate.
Target Users:
This worksheet is ideal for elementary school students in grades 1-3 who are learning about adjectives. It can be used in the classroom as a grammar exercise or at home for extra practice. It is also suitable for ESL learners who are developing their English vocabulary and grammar skills.
